Transaction 16579afabe747823a91b9e47af4142303ffa721d36b7e39b57c72dc757535d07
1 Input
2 Outputs
- 16579afabe747823a91b9e47af4142303ffa721d36b7e39b57c72dc757535d07:0
- 16579afabe747823a91b9e47af4142303ffa721d36b7e39b57c72dc757535d07:1
value 11757500
address 1FZMeNsqbieu6p3SbnMewVhHiXA19a8Pw1
value 13304856
address 13ZPXk1XJ7AaFfHyR21bhHGVHpNDW1CZGQ